										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p class="wp-block-paragraph"><strong>What pieces or projects have you been working on lately?</strong><br>Lately I have been spending a lot of time within my own archive of work, which is comprised entirely of 35mm film photography. I find that I benefit when I give myself time and space away from my images so that I can revisit them with fresh eyes. The act of being reflective is a crucial part of my creative process, and I love seeing what images I gravitate towards, as well as what new themes and feelings emerge as I revisit them after some time.</p>

<p class="wp-block-paragraph"><strong>What did you learn (or unlearn) while working on them?</strong><br>I am trying to be a little kinder to myself in my criticisms of my work. As I primarily shoot film, some of my earliest works reflect the learning curve that comes with film as a medium. In revisiting my images, I am trying to hold more grace for the process, gratitude for all that I have learned, and to be a little gentler in my critiques!</p>

<p class="wp-block-paragraph"><strong>What words, ideas or emotions were going through your head?</strong><br>Some words that come to mind right away are hope, joy, nostalgia, and gratitude. Revisiting work can trigger so many emotions; some new, some old, but I am of the belief that the best works make you feel something, so I am appreciative of the breadth of feelings that have come to the surface in this process.</p>

<p class="wp-block-paragraph"><strong>Were there any conversations, movies, music, or books that made their way into that work?</strong><br>I live in the US, and it goes without saying that the US continues to be a topic of conversation globally for many unfortunate and tragic reasons. Naturally, a consequence of this is that I have been engaged in many conversations with those around me. There are a few themes that continue to emerge, specifically regarding place, identity, and belonging. As I grapple with these themes on both a large and more personal scale, I find that in revisiting my work, I am drawn to images that anchor me to parts of my life that can at times feel distant, but also act as joyful reminders of memories I cherish.</p>

<p class="wp-block-paragraph"><strong>What's been the most difficult thing you've faced recently in your creative process?</strong><br>Admittedly, the dark, cold months of winter are where I tend to struggle the most from a creative perspective. I find it difficult to muster up the motivation to get out and shoot, especially when there is less light to chase. Digging into your own archives is a welcome practice when you are hibernating!</p>
